First Look: March Comes in Like a Lion

At 17 years old, Rei Kiriyama is already living alone, funded by his winnings as a renowned shogi prodigy. Outside of his professional life however, things are much tougher as Rei struggles in his relationship with family and friends.

First Look: Classicaloid

“Classicaloid” versions of classical music composers like Beethoven and Mozart have appeared in modern day Japan. They look like normal people (in slightly weird clothes) but when they play their “musique”, very strange things begin to happen.

First Look: Flip Flappers

Cocona is an ordinary middle school girl in an ordinary town, but one day she runs into the mysterious Papika, a sky-surfing girl accompanied by a fussy robot. Together they’re spirited away to the world of Pure Illusion, a mysterious alternate dimension full of whimsy and danger.

First Look: ViVid Strike!

Fuka Reventon is an orphaned girl who struggles to get by and often resorts to street fighting. Found beaten up and abandoned by Einhardt Stratos, a member of the Nakajima gym, she’s offered the chance to join their martial arts team and come face to face with a friend from her past.
